Buccaneers insider Jon Ledyard joined the show. Jon did not have high praise for Byron Leftwich because he hasn’t proven to be someone that can change or adapt from year to year. He actually gave Matt Canada props for doing that in the middle of this season. Jon said Leftwich was the guy that ran the offense on game days and did the game planning in Tampa Bay and it wasn’t just Bruce Arians calling all the shots. Jon thinks the overall playbook from Leftwich and Arians isn’t as strong as it’s perceived in the league. He said it counts a lot on the players being at an elite level. He said the in-game evolution of the offense is almost nonexistent. Jon talked about the predictability of the offense is bad and the success only comes from Tom Brady in a no-huddle approach. He expects Leftwich to consider his options, but would certainly have interest from Pittsburgh. His overall grade for Leftwich in his time in Tampa is a C because there were great things, but last year earned him an F.
